"Celebrate 25 years of Harley Quinn in this brand new hardcover collecting the infamous Suicide Squad outlaw's most memorable stories! Since her debut in 1992's Batman: The Animated Series, Harley Quinn has wreaked havoc throughout the DC Universe with her zany, twisted ways. From her time as Dr. Harleen Quinzel, the Joker's psychiatrist, to her transformation into the sometimes hilarious, sometimes tragic, and always villainous Harely Quinn, celebrate twenty-five years with the most acclaimed writers and artists that have contributed to Harley's raucous adventures!"--

The story opens with some development in the Madison storyline. She is in the process of hiring the biggest guns she can find and tossing them in Harley's directon, hoping that they will have the ability to take her out.

The scene changes and we find Harley at a hot tub with senior citizen cyborg, Sy Borgman. She is trying to keep the man busy as the rest of the crew get the surprise party together for him. As the two head back, Harley finds that the party that was planned was actually for her. Here we have a reunion of sorts with the Gotham Sirens. Of course, Harley is always happy to see Ivy. :D

As the party gets into full swing so does Harley. She ends up jumping out the window and into the arms of Power Girl.
